Legal Aid Clinic receives R1 million

The Stellenbosch University (SU) Legal Aid Clinic will continue to provide access to free, effective and quality legal services, fight illegal evictions on behalf of farm workers, give law students the opportunity to develop practical skills in a clinical setting, and do ongoing research in eviction law – all thanks to the support of partners such as the Claude Leon Foundation.

The Claude Leon Foundation has supported the Legal Aid Clinic since 2007 and recently announced the continuation of this aid with a grant of R1 million spread over two years starting from 2018.

This South African charitable trust has been a valuable partner of SU for more than 30 years and has contributed more than R45 million towards postdoctoral fellowships, merit awards for lecturers, honours bursaries and the expansion and operations of the Legal Aid Clinic, among others.

The foundation originated from a bequest made by Claude Leon (1884–1972) in 1962. Leon was the founder and managing director of the Elephant Trading Company and helped start and finance several large South African companies, including Anglovaal, OK Bazaars and Edgars.

The Claude Leon Foundation supports projects that tie in with its five strategic themes: building research capacity in higher education, supporting innovation in schooling, early childhood development, defending democracy, and building opportunities for post-school youth.

“We thank the Claude Leon Foundation for its continued support of and investment in what we do. We truly value the significant contribution that this foundation continues to make to the Legal Aid Clinic and the community we serve," said Mr Theo Broodryk of SU's Faculty of Law.

“As we regard their work to be of considerable importance, we are delighted to continue our close association with the Legal Aid Clinic," said Mr William (Bill) Frankel (OBE), chairperson of the foundation.
